$157,099in research payments, 2019–2025

Across 4 payments — averaging $39,275 each. Payments tied to a research study. These frequently flow through the physician to a hospital or research institution rather than to the physician personally.

What this is not: this is the amount Original Medicare Part B allowed for services this provider billed in 2024. It is not their income. It excludes Medicare Advantage — now more than half of all Medicare enrollment — along with Medicaid and all commercial insurance, and it is gross practice revenue before staff, rent, supplies and malpractice premiums. CMS also suppresses any figure covering ten or fewer patients, so low-volume providers appear smaller than they are.
